The business of manufacturing and supplying
granite monuments and precast burial vaults
has never been more challenging. Increasing
costs are forcing more families to opt for
cremation rather than a traditional burial. More
cemetaries are insisting on bronze markers
set level with the ground to facilitate easier
maintenance. As a result, the demand for
granite monuments has been reduced.
In this fast-changing industry, the companies
that remain competitive and profitable are
those that are ready and willing to change the
way they do things. Take the handling and
delivery of burial vaults as an example. The
need for maximum efficiency and versatility
has never been greater. That’s why more
companies, from small businesses delivering
monuments to large precast concrete
manufacturers are replacing their existing
equipment with a HIAB knuckleboom crane.
A better way of working
The HIAB knuckleboom crane outperforms
traditional handling and delivery systems in a
number of important ways.
In the yard, the HIAB crane can load itself
from any position, easily reaching over other
markers to lift the marker and base that the
customer wants.
The HIAB’s articulating boom system is also
a major advantage at the cemetary. The
boom pivots and telescopes at several points,
enabling the operator to easily maneuver
stones or vaults into position while avoiding
obstructions between the truck and the burial
site. Traditional equipment, such as small
trucks and trailers equipped with overhead
monorail systems, don’t allow you to position
the load directly over the grave site and risk
damaging nearby markers. Trucks equipped
with corner-mounted service cranes give you
the same problem. Also, the service crane
typically requires a steep boom angle for
heavier loads - not good where trees or other
overhead obstructions exist. Additionally,
these methods all use winches, resulting in
more manual intervention due to load sway all of which consume your valuable time.

XS Drive remote control
gives you complete
mastery
The HIAB XS Drive remote control
makes you more efficient by giving
you freedom of movement and the
best possible position to view the
load. This leads to safer and more
efficient deliveries and can eliminate
the need for a second worker.
Ergonomically designed, the XS Drive
offers fluid radio communication,
controlling up to 24 fully proportional
functions.

OLP is a system that monitors the
crane’s capacity. During operation,
if you reach 90% of the crane’s
capacity, the OLP system will give
you a visual and audible alert. Should
you reach capacity, the crane will only
allow you to do “radius decreasing”
functions.
OLP is very discrete, running in the
background, and is never intrusive but it is ever vigilant and always on
guard for your safety, should it be
called upon.
